Church Fathers on Galatians 1:22
“And I was still unknown by face unto the Churches of Judæa; but they only heard say, he that once persecuted us now preaches the faith of which he once made havoc.” What modesty in thus again mentioning the facts of his persecuting and laying waste the Church, and in thus making infamous his former life, while he passes over the illustrious deeds he was about to achieve!
